Computer Graphics By Zhigang Xiang Roy A Plastock Pdf -

Many learners search for this text to build a robust foundation in rendering, transformation, and geometric modeling. This article explores the core concepts covered in the book, its unique pedagogical value, and how to effectively utilize it for mastering computer graphics. 1. Overview of the Book

Optimized for independent study with hundreds of worked examples. Amazon.com Core Themes & Content

: Translating, scaling, and rotating objects on a flat plane.

: Breaks down the midpoint circle algorithm for raster screens.

Zhigang Xiang’s text focuses heavily on the fixed-function pipeline . It does not teach modern shader languages (GLSL/HLSL) in the way modern APIs require. You will learn how perspective projection works, but you might not learn how to write a compute shader. Computer Graphics By Zhigang Xiang Roy A Plastock Pdf

: Contains over 350 solved problems with step-by-step annotations to reinforce learning. Key Topics Covered

The book is structured into thematic chapters that guide a student from basic pixel manipulation to complex 3D scenes: Image Foundations: Explains how computers represent visual data using the RGB color model , lookup tables, and various image file formats. Scan Conversion:

, making the logic applicable across different programming environments. It is commonly used as a supplement to primary textbooks in courses such as: Internet Archive Introduction to Computer Graphics Computer Animation Placement Computer Science Suranaree University of Technology If you'd like, I can help you find specific solved problems from the book or explain a particular

While I cannot provide a direct PDF file, you can access the material through these platforms: Schaum's Outline of Computer Graphics - Amazon.com Many learners search for this text to build

Translation, rotation, scaling, and shear in 2D and 3D space Schaum's Outline - Scribd .

Authored by Zhigang Xiang and Roy A. Plastock, Schaum's Outline of Theory and Problems of Computer Graphics takes a goal-oriented approach to discussing the fundamental concepts, underlying mathematics, and algorithms of image synthesis. It provides a bridge between the highly abstract mathematical theories of rendering and practical programming applications. 1. Bridging the Gap: Theory to Practical Algorithms

Before a computer can display a line or a circle, it must convert mathematical equations into discrete pixels on a screen. This process is known as scan conversion or rasterization. The book covers:

: Utilizing homogeneous coordinates and matrix multiplication for 3D space. Overview of the Book Optimized for independent study

One of the hallmarks of this text is its ability to demystify complex algorithms. Before rendering a 3D scene, a computer must translate mathematical descriptions into pixels on a screen. The book covers foundational concepts like:

Algorithms like Cohen-Sutherland and Sutherland-Hodgeman.

) is a widely utilized academic resource designed to simplify the complex mathematical and algorithmic foundations of image synthesis. The book is primarily recognized for its problem-oriented approach, providing over 350 solved problems and step-by-step explanations for 2D and 3D graphics. Suranaree University of Technology Quick Facts Zhigang Xiang Roy A. Plastock part of the Schaum's Outline Series McGraw-Hill